            /// <summary>
            /// Executes the create shift staging workflow.
            /// </summary>
            /// <param name="request">The new Shift request.</param>
            /// <returns>The new Shift response.</returns>
            protected override ChangeShiftStatusResponse Process(ChangeShiftStatusRequest request)
            {
                ThrowIf.Null(request, "request");
                ThrowIf.Null(request.ShiftTerminalId, "request.ShiftTerminalId");

                if (this.Context.GetTerminal() != null)
                {
                    request.TerminalId = this.Context.GetTerminal().TerminalId;
                }

                EmployeePermissions permissions = EmployeePermissionHelper.GetEmployeePermissions(this.Context, this.Context.GetPrincipal().UserId);
                bool includeSharedShifts        = permissions.HasManagerPrivileges || permissions.AllowManageSharedShift || permissions.AllowUseSharedShift;
                var  staffId    = this.Context.GetPrincipal().UserId;
                var  terminalId = request.ShiftTerminalId;
                var  shifts     = ShiftDataDataServiceHelper.GetShifts(
                    this.Context,
                    this.Context.GetPrincipal().ChannelId,
                    terminalId,
                    request.ShiftId,
                    includeSharedShifts);

                Shift shift = ShiftDataDataServiceHelper.FilterShifts(shifts, terminalId, staffId).FirstOrDefault();

                if (shift == null)
                {
                    throw new DataValidationException(DataValidationErrors.Microsoft_Dynamics_Commerce_Runtime_ObjectNotFound, "There is no shift with the given identifier.");
                }

                ShiftTransitionHelper shiftTransitionHelper = new ShiftTransitionHelper(this.Context, request);

                // Validate if the change of shift status can be performed
                shiftTransitionHelper.TransitShiftStatus(shift);

                shift.StatusDateTime = this.Context.GetNowInChannelTimeZone();

                UpdateShiftStagingTableDataRequest dataServiceRequest = new UpdateShiftStagingTableDataRequest(shift);

                request.RequestContext.Runtime.Execute <NullResponse>(dataServiceRequest, this.Context);

                this.SaveTransactionLog(shift, request.TransactionId);

                if (request.ToStatus == ShiftStatus.Closed)
                {
                    this.PurgeSalesTransactionData(request.RequestContext);
                }

                return(new ChangeShiftStatusResponse(shift));
            }

            /// <summary>
            /// Executes the resume shift workflow.
            /// </summary>
            /// <param name="request">The new shift request.</param>
            /// <returns>The resume shift response.</returns>
            protected override ResumeShiftResponse Process(ResumeShiftRequest request)
            {
                ThrowIf.Null(request, "request");
                ThrowIf.Null(request.ShiftTerminalId, "request.ShiftTerminalId");

                if (this.Context.GetTerminal() != null)
                {
                    request.TerminalId = this.Context.GetTerminal().TerminalId;
                }

                bool includeSharedShifts = this.Permissions.HasManagerPrivileges || this.Permissions.AllowManageSharedShift || this.Permissions.AllowUseSharedShift;
                var  staffId             = this.Context.GetPrincipal().UserId;
                var  terminalId          = request.ShiftTerminalId;
                var  shifts = ShiftDataDataServiceHelper.GetShifts(
                    this.Context,
                    this.Context.GetPrincipal().ChannelId,
                    terminalId,
                    request.ShiftId,
                    includeSharedShifts);

                Shift shift = ShiftDataDataServiceHelper.FilterShifts(shifts, terminalId, staffId).FirstOrDefault();

                this.ValidateCanResumeShift(request, shift);

                shift.CashDrawer        = request.CashDrawer;
                shift.CurrentStaffId    = this.Context.GetPrincipal().UserId;
                shift.CurrentTerminalId = request.TerminalId;
                shift.Status            = ShiftStatus.Open;
                shift.StatusDateTime    = this.Context.GetNowInChannelTimeZone();

                UpdateShiftStagingTableDataRequest dataServiceRequest = new UpdateShiftStagingTableDataRequest(shift);

                request.RequestContext.Runtime.Execute <NullResponse>(dataServiceRequest, this.Context);

                return(new ResumeShiftResponse(shift));
            }

            /// <summary>
            /// Executes the workflow to get available Shifts.
            /// </summary>
            /// <param name="request">The request.</param>
            /// <returns>The response.</returns>
            protected override GetAvailableShiftsResponse Process(GetAvailableShiftsRequest request)
            {
                ThrowIf.Null(request, "request");

                IEnumerable <Shift> shifts;
                EmployeePermissions employeePermission = EmployeePermissionHelper.GetEmployeePermissions(this.Context, this.Context.GetPrincipal().UserId);

                var staffId = this.Context.GetPrincipal().UserId;

                GetCurrentTerminalIdDataRequest dataRequest = new GetCurrentTerminalIdDataRequest();
                string terminalId = this.Context.Execute <SingleEntityDataServiceResponse <string> >(dataRequest).Entity;

                bool isManager = this.Context.GetPrincipal().IsInRole(AuthenticationHelper.ManagerPrivilegies);
                bool readAllShifts;
                bool includeSharedShifts;

                switch (request.Status)
                {
                case ShiftStatus.Suspended:
                case ShiftStatus.BlindClosed:
                    includeSharedShifts = employeePermission.AllowManageSharedShift;

                    // If user is manager or has permission to logon multiple shifts or allowed to manage shared shifts)
                    // Read all shifts including shared
                    // Else read only shifts that belong to the user and are not shared shifts.
                    if (isManager || (employeePermission.AllowMultipleShiftLogOn && includeSharedShifts))
                    {
                        // Read all shifts
                        shifts = ShiftDataDataServiceHelper.GetAllStoreShiftsWithStatus(this.Context, this.Context.GetPrincipal().ChannelId, request.Status, request.QueryResultSettings, true);
                    }
                    else if (employeePermission.AllowMultipleShiftLogOn && !includeSharedShifts)
                    {
                        shifts = ShiftDataDataServiceHelper.GetShiftsForStaffWithStatus(this.Context, this.Context.GetPrincipal().ChannelId, request.Status, request.QueryResultSettings, false);
                    }
                    else if (includeSharedShifts && !employeePermission.AllowMultipleShiftLogOn)
                    {
                        var allShifts = ShiftDataDataServiceHelper.GetShiftsForStaffWithStatus(this.Context, this.Context.GetPrincipal().ChannelId, request.Status, request.QueryResultSettings, true);

                        // Exclude non shared shifts and shift not opened or used by the current staff id.
                        shifts = allShifts.Where(s => (s.IsShared == true || s.CurrentStaffId == staffId || s.StaffId == staffId));
                    }
                    else
                    {
                        shifts = ShiftDataDataServiceHelper.GetShiftsForStaffWithStatus(this.Context, this.Context.GetPrincipal().ChannelId, staffId, request.Status, request.QueryResultSettings, false);
                    }

                    break;

                case ShiftStatus.Open:

                    includeSharedShifts = employeePermission.AllowManageSharedShift || employeePermission.AllowUseSharedShift;
                    readAllShifts       = isManager || (includeSharedShifts && employeePermission.AllowMultipleShiftLogOn);

                    // If user is manager or (has permission to logon multiple shifts and allowed to manage or use shared shifts)
                    // Read all terminal shifts including shared
                    // Else read only shifts that belong to the user and are not shared shifts.
                    if (readAllShifts)
                    {
                        var openShiftsOnTerminal    = ShiftDataDataServiceHelper.GetAllOpenedShiftsOnTerminal(this.Context, this.Context.GetPrincipal().ChannelId, terminalId, false);
                        var openSharedShiftsOnStore = ShiftDataDataServiceHelper.GetAllOpenedSharedShiftsOnStore(this.Context, this.Context.GetPrincipal().ChannelId);
                        shifts = openShiftsOnTerminal.Union(openSharedShiftsOnStore);
                    }
                    else
                    {
                        IEnumerable <Shift> usableShifts;
                        if (employeePermission.AllowMultipleShiftLogOn)
                        {
                            usableShifts = ShiftDataDataServiceHelper.GetAllOpenedShiftsOnTerminal(this.Context, this.Context.GetPrincipal().ChannelId, terminalId, false);
                        }
                        else
                        {
                            usableShifts = ShiftDataDataServiceHelper.GetOpenedShiftsOnTerminalForStaff(this.Context, this.Context.GetPrincipal().ChannelId, staffId, terminalId, false);
                        }

                        if (includeSharedShifts)
                        {
                            var openSharedShiftsOnStore = ShiftDataDataServiceHelper.GetAllOpenedSharedShiftsOnStore(this.Context, this.Context.GetPrincipal().ChannelId);
                            shifts = usableShifts.Union(openSharedShiftsOnStore);
                        }
                        else
                        {
                            shifts = usableShifts;
                        }
                    }

                    break;

                default:
                    shifts = new Shift[] { };
                    break;
                }

                if (shifts != null || shifts.Count() != 0)
                {
                    shifts = ShiftDataDataServiceHelper.FilterShifts(shifts, terminalId, staffId);
                }

                return(new GetAvailableShiftsResponse(shifts.AsPagedResult()));
            }
